4 killed in Coach accident in Southwest China

Arab Today, arab today

Arab Today, arab today 4 killed in Coach accident in Southwest China

Chongqing - SPA

A long-distance bus plunged into a roadside ditch in southwest China Wednesday, killing at least four people and injuring an unspecified number of others, local authorities said. The bus, carrying 36 people, broke through a guardrail and plunged into a ditch in Wuxi County, located in the municipality of Chongqing, Xinhua quoted a county government spokesman as saying. Local residents rushed to the scene and rescued the passengers from the ditch, the spokesman said. An unspecified number of injured people were sent to nearby hospitals, and their conditions were described as stable. Local police are investigating the cause of the accident, the spokesman said.
